Output 31890710aec6bc1555f3fba6bf80a141c3bc50a008f00492d934f3b85d2f1e8c:16

value
783414
script pubkey
OP_0 OP_PUSHBYTES_20 3d0a6e28bc1453e7d96e68f540891b909258ae58
address
bc1q859xu29uz3f70ktwdr65pzgmjzf93tjcamyh2y
transaction
31890710aec6bc1555f3fba6bf80a141c3bc50a008f00492d934f3b85d2f1e8c
spent
true